Of course, the game is much different now than it was then. Players are bigger, faster, and as a whole more athletic. Also, shooting has become more of a refined art — so it's totally understandable that Nash is a much better shooter. Also contributing to the vast difference in their career shooting percentages — 37.5% for Cousy to 48.7% for Nash — is that the confrontational, hands-on defensive tactics that Cousy faced have been outlawed.

Excluding his first four years in the league when he was a backup with Phoenix and Dallas, Nash's points-per-game average is 14.8, appreciably less than Cousy's 18.4 ppg. However, Cousy attempted 17.8 shots per game, while Nash only puts up 10.7 shots.

Contrary to your remembrances, however, Nash has a trickier handle and can therefore score in a wider variety of self-created situations.

All things considered, Nash is a superior scorer.

Assists are awarded more liberally these days, so Cousy's 7.5 lifetime assists per game is roughly equivalent to the 9.5 assists that Nash averaged in his peak seasons. Cousy did lead the NBA in assists for eight consecutive seasons (1953-60), while Nash led in only three seasons (2005-07). However, Cousy's primary competitors were the likes of Dick McGuire, Andy Phillip and Bob Davies — great players, yet not in the same class as Jason Kidd and Chris Paul.

Also, as far as pure passing ability is concerned, Nash has a very slight edge only because his left hand is more developed than was Cousy's in this category.

Neither was an adequate defender in man-to-man situations. For most of his career, Cousy had Bill Russell prowling the lane to erase all of his own defensive mistakes. But Nash is more on his own, so his defensive lapses are more evident and more damaging. Overall, neither player has an advantage here.

It says here that Nash's advantages in speed, quickness, athleticism and shooting make him the superior player.

In fact, Cousy's inadequacies in these departments would disqualify him from even making a modern-day NBA roster.

Speaking of coaches' halftime tantrums:

Unless they can scream and yell at their kids, their spouses, their dogs or whatever during the offseason, coaches usually suffer some degree of throat soreness once training camp begins. And that's exactly what happened to Phil Jackson early in my first season as his assistant with the Albany Patroons in the CBA.

During the training camp and the first two or three games, I had never addressed the entire team. Instead, during the games and the practice sessions, I spoke only to individual players — mostly the big men — and to Phil.
